Computational linguistics refers to the scientific study of language from a computational perspective. It is an interdisciplinary field the makes use of concepts from computer science, linguistics, logic, artificial intelligence, philosophy and cognitive science. Natural language processing deals with the study of interactions between human language and computers. It also involves the programming of computers for the processing and analysis of large amounts of natural language data. There are theoretical and applied components of linguistics. Theoretical computational linguistics involves the development of formal theories related to grammar and semantics. Within applied computational linguistics, the statistical methods and machine learning algorithms are applied to natural language processing tasks.
